5. Stopping the Measurement
In the step 4, after you press TEST button, the display shows TEST
it means high voltage is being outputted.
About 30 seconds later, TEST turns off, it means the high voltage
output stops, meanwhile the measurement stops automatically.
If you want to perform measurement continuously, you should press
LOCK key before TEST turns off.

4.9. MIN/MAX Recording Mode
The MIN/MAX mode records minimum and maximum values of all input
values since this mode is activated.
When the inputs go below the recorded minimum value or above the
recorded maximum value, the meter records the new value.
To use MIN/MAX recording:
*
Make sure the meter is in the desired function and range.
*
Press the MAX/MIN button to activate the MIN/MAX mode and the
display shows the maximum reading, meanwhile MAX appears as
an indicator.
*
Press the MAX/MIN button to step through the minimum reading
(MIN appears) and the present reading (MAX and MIN flicker), and
the maximum reading /MAX appears), and so on.
*
To exit and erase stored readings, press and hold down the
MAX/MIN button for more than 1 second or turn the range switch.
